Aquamarine Gemstone Beads

During the latest gem show adventure I was instantly drawn to these luscious strands of aquamarine. Though I no longer work with beads, I couldn't resist turning these jewels into jewelry.  

These raw cut aquamarine are interrupted with diamond-tipped golden rods. The chocolate diamonds total a quarter carat, and add a neutral sparkle to the fresh blue of the necklace.

  

   

This handmade black and gold link chain centers a tapering set of chunky oceanic aquamarine pillars. Little white diamonds wink in the rivets connecting the two worlds of gemstones and metal.
